Strong Random Password Generator

Password Generator

Generate unlimited strong, unique passwords in seconds.

12
10

Character Options

Pro tip: For maximum security, use passwords with at least 12 characters including uppercase, lowercase, numbers, and symbols. Avoid using the same password across multiple accounts.

This browser-based Password Generator creates strong, random passwords using fully customizable character sets — including uppercase, lowercase, numbers, symbols, and custom characters. Furthermore, it displays real-time strength scores and entropy ratings per result. Additionally, you can generate multiple passwords at once and, consequently, copy or download them instantly — no installation or account needed.

Core Features

Fully Customizable Character Sets

Build your ideal password using any combination of uppercase letters, lowercase letters, numbers, and symbols. Additionally, you can include custom characters or, alternatively, exclude ambiguous and similar-looking ones — consequently producing passwords that are both secure and easy to read.

Real-Time Strength Score & Entropy Rating

Each generated password instantly receives a strength rating alongside a calculated entropy score. Furthermore, color-coded indicators make it easy to assess security level at a glance — consequently helping you select the most suitable result for your specific use case.

Bulk Generation with Copy & Download

Generate multiple unique passwords in a single click, then copy them individually or all at once. Moreover, download the full list as a plain text file — therefore making it easy to store, share, or document credentials efficiently during any workflow.

Supported Options & Capabilities

Lowercase Letters
Uppercase Letters
Numbers
Symbols & Special Characters
Custom Character Input
Ambiguous Character Exclusion
Similar Character Exclusion
Real-Time Strength Rating
Entropy Score Display
Bulk Password Generation
Copy to Clipboard
Download as Text File

Fully browser-based — therefore, no installation, no login, and no passwords stored on any server

Professional Use Cases

Account Registration & Onboarding

When signing up for new platforms or services, use this tool to generate a unique, strong credential for every account. Consequently, you eliminate password reuse — which is, moreover, the leading cause of credential-based breaches across personal and professional accounts.

Developer & QA Testing Environments

Developers and testers need temporary, realistic credentials for staging environments and automated test suites. This tool generates multiple secure passwords at once and, furthermore, downloads them as a file — consequently streamlining test data preparation without any manual effort.

IT Admin & Bulk Credential Setup

System administrators setting up new user accounts require strong, non-repeating passwords in bulk. With this tool, they can generate entire batches at once and, moreover, export them as a text file — therefore reducing both manual effort and organizational security risk.

Technical Specifications

Character Types
Lowercase, uppercase, numbers, symbols, and custom characters
Exclusion Options
Ambiguous characters, similar-looking characters, or both combined
Strength Levels
Very Weak, Weak, Medium, Strong, Very Strong
Entropy Display
Calculated per password based on character set and length
Export Options
Copy to clipboard or download entire list as TXT file
Setup Required
None — fully browser-based, zero configuration needed

Frequently Asked Questions

An online Password Generator creates random, secure passwords based on character rules you define — such as which types of characters to include or exclude. As a result, you receive credentials that are far harder to guess or crack than anything manually created, and you can do this instantly without installing any software.
No. Passwords are generated entirely within your browser session and are never transmitted to or stored on any server. Furthermore, once you close or refresh the page, all generated results are cleared immediately — consequently making it safe to generate passwords for real accounts during active use.
You can include any combination of lowercase letters, uppercase letters, numbers, and symbols. Additionally, you can enter your own custom characters to extend the character pool. Each selected type is blended into the output — consequently increasing the overall complexity and randomness of every generated password.
The strength rating evaluates each generated password based on factors like length, character variety, and repetition patterns. Ratings range from Very Weak to Very Strong and are displayed with color indicators — therefore letting you immediately assess which passwords are suitable for sensitive accounts versus lower-risk uses.
Entropy measures how unpredictable a password is, calculated in bits based on the character set size and password length. The higher the entropy, the harder the password is to crack through brute-force methods. Consequently, the entropy score shown alongside each password helps you choose credentials with the best possible resistance to automated attacks.
Ambiguous characters are those that look nearly identical in certain fonts — such as the letter O and the number 0, or the letter l and the number 1. Excluding them prevents misreading when typing passwords manually. Furthermore, enabling this option makes passwords more practical to transcribe without reducing overall security significantly.
Yes. The tool supports bulk generation — allowing you to produce a list of unique passwords in a single action. Each result is displayed with its own individual strength rating and entropy score. Moreover, you can copy them all at once or download the full list as a text file — consequently making batch credential creation fast and efficient.
Use Copy to Clipboard to instantly paste any individual password into a form, document, or password manager. Alternatively, Copy All captures every generated password at once, and Download saves the complete list as a plain text file. In either case, the exported output is clean and formatted — consequently simplifying storage and team sharing.
Password managers require installation, an account, and often lock advanced generation features behind subscriptions. This Password Generator, on the other hand, works instantly in any browser with zero setup and no account required. Therefore, it is ideal for quick generation, bulk exports, and use on shared or restricted devices where installing software is not an option.
A secure password is long, random, and unique to each account. It combines multiple character types, avoids predictable patterns, and is never reused across services. This tool addresses all of these factors simultaneously — consequently producing credentials that are cryptographically unpredictable and resistant to dictionary attacks, brute-force attempts, and credential-stuffing methods.